The Making of Western Europe V2 is a historical book written by Charles Robert Leslie Fletcher in 1915. The book is an attempt to trace the fortunes of the children of the Roman Empire, with a focus on the development of Western Europe. The author explores the various factors that contributed to the shaping of the region's history, including the influence of the Roman Empire, the rise of Christianity, and the impact of various invasions and migrations. The book is divided into several chapters, each of which covers a specific period or event in the history of Western Europe. Through detailed analysis and insightful commentary, the author provides readers with a comprehensive understanding of the region's past and how it has influenced the present.
